Product Description:
The HDS05.2-W300N-HT05-01-FW is a drive controller produced by Bosch Rexroth Indramat within the HDS Drive Controllers series. As a modular main unit, this controller supplies and manages power to matched servo drives in multi-axis DIAX04 racks. In industrial automation, it executes axis command data, modulates current, and enforces protection routines so connected motors can follow motion profiles under closed-loop control. Its modular format supports rack-based systems where several axes operate from a shared power structure and coordinated control architecture.
The power section is dimensioned for a continuous bus current of 300 A, enabling use with medium-to-high torque servo motors without external boosters. Command data reach the unit through the SERCOS fiber-optic interface, allowing deterministic cycle times and electrical isolation from control cabinet wiring. As part of the DIAX04 family, it uses standardized parameter lists so axis modules in the same rack share identical telegram structures. Thermal management is handled by a built-in air blower, which draws cabinet air through dedicated channels and helps prevent heat accumulation on the IGBT stack. The device is part of Line 05, so common power and signal backplanes align with that generation's mechanical footprint.
The drive is Version 2, with updated gate-drive circuitry and diagnostic registers compared with the initial release. The unit is an HDS Drive Controller, and installation parameters such as DC bus voltage, encoder evaluation slots, and fault relay wiring follow the same product group. This keeps the controller aligned with the slot assignments and electrical connection scheme used in the rack. The part number suffix indicates a firmware-related option, but the controller hardware remains unchanged in its main operating role.
